The DVSA have announced that from Monday 14 June 2021 driving examiners will return to offering 7 driving tests a day instead of 6 – which is the number carried out before the pandemic.
Tests will begin to be added to the system from 9 June, increasing the number of appointments available.
They are also reintroducing the 3 working day short notice cancellation period for practical car tests.
This was suspended when we restarted testing following the first lockdown in August 2020.
All tests taking place from Thursday 17 June 2021 will be subject to the 3 working day short notice cancellation period.
If you need to cancel a test within the 3 working day period as a result of a positive COVID-19 test result or having to self-isolate you will need to email the DVSA at [email protected]
Please put – COVID SHORT NOTICE CANCELLATION – in the subject of your email and they say they will look to reschedule your test for the earliest possible appointment.
If you have cancelled as a result of COVID-19 the booking will be made for a date after you have finished self-isolating.
You may be asked to provide evidence when cancelling at short notice.
If you need to cancel your test for any other reason or do not turn up for your test you will lose your test fee.
